Cutworms tend to target the most vulnerable part of a young plant, making freshly seeded Michigan fall gardens especially at risk after late summer planting.

These pests usually attack right at the soil line, chewing through tender stems and causing seedlings to topple over seemingly overnight.

Damage often shows up first in the weakest, most crowded areas of a bed where seedlings compete for space. Cutworms are most active during the evening and nighttime hours, making them easy to miss during a quick daytime check.

Placing a simple collar made from cardboard or foil around each stem can block their access effectively. Checking soil near damaged seedlings often reveals curled, gray caterpillars hiding just below the surface.

Clearing garden debris before planting reduces hiding spots for cutworms to settle into. A little prevention now protects your fall seedlings during their most fragile stage.

1. At The Stem Where It Meets The Soil

At The Stem Where It Meets The Soil

Picture stepping out to your garden on a crisp Michigan morning and finding a healthy-looking seedling just lying there, completely separated from its roots.

That telltale sign points straight to the most common cutworm feeding spot: the thin zone where a tender stem meets the soil surface.

Cutworms are moth larvae that feed mostly at night, and they target this exact location because the stem tissue there is soft, moist, and easy to chew through.

The damage often looks clean, almost like someone snipped the seedling with small scissors. Lettuce, cabbage, kale, broccoli, and beans are especially vulnerable because their stems stay soft and narrow during the first week or two after germination.

A single larva can work through several seedlings in one night before curling back into the soil by morning.

Checking your rows every single morning during those first growth stages makes a huge difference. Walk the bed slowly and look for stems that lean, wilt, or have completely toppled.

If you spot a freshly clipped stem, gently dig into the surrounding soil within a few inches because the larva often rests just beneath the surface nearby. Catching it early stops further damage before it spreads down the row.

Physical barriers like small cardboard collars pressed an inch into the soil around each seedling can protect that vulnerable stem zone and buy your plants time to grow thicker and stronger.

2. Just Beneath The Soil Surface

Just Beneath The Soil Surface

Not every cutworm feeds above the ground where you can easily spot the problem. Some species work just below the soil surface, chewing through the lower stem or root crown before any obvious above-ground sign appears.

The confusing part is that the leaves can look perfectly fine at first glance, yet the plant has already lost its anchor and will soon wilt or pull loose with almost no resistance.

Michigan gardeners sometimes assume drought stress or transplant shock caused a seedling to suddenly collapse, but a quick check beneath the surface tells the real story. Gently press your finger into the soil right beside the base of a struggling plant.

If the stem feels loose or breaks away easily, something has been feeding below ground. Look for a plump, smooth-skinned larva curled into a tight C shape, which is the classic resting posture cutworms take when they get disturbed.

Subsurface feeding tends to happen more often in heavier, moister soils where larvae can move freely just under the surface without drying out.

Garden beds with good organic matter and consistent moisture, which are exactly the conditions most Michigan fall gardeners aim for, can also attract more of this underground activity.

Probing the top inch or two of soil around any suspicious seedling is a smart daily habit during the first two weeks after planting.

Finding the larva before it moves to the next plant is the most direct way to stop the damage from spreading further through your fall bed.

3. Along Rows Of Newly Emerged Seedlings

Along Rows Of Newly Emerged Seedlings

Freshly emerged rows carry a quiet excitement for any gardener, but those tiny seedlings are also at their most exposed.

Right after germination, stems are at their narrowest and most tender, making them far easier for a cutworm to work through compared to a plant that has been growing for several weeks.

A single larva moving along a row can leave behind a trail of clipped or missing plants that follows the planting line almost perfectly. Spotting a pattern of damage is actually one of the most useful clues you have.

Random missing plants scattered across the bed might point to other causes, but a sequence of two, three, or four clipped seedlings in a straight line strongly suggests a cutworm moved from one plant to the next during a single night.

The larva does not always travel far, but it can cover enough ground to damage several seedlings before returning to the soil before sunrise.

When you find that kind of row damage, mark the last affected plant with a small stake or flag and then look carefully at the healthy seedlings within the next foot or two.

The cutworm may have paused nearby and could still be resting in the soil close to the next target.

Scouting at dusk or just after dark with a small flashlight gives you the best chance of actually spotting the larva on the soil surface before it feeds again.

Catching it at that point protects the remaining seedlings and keeps your fall row intact through the critical early weeks of growth.

4. Around Newly Set Fall Transplants

Around Newly Set Fall Transplants

Transplants go through a stressful adjustment period right after they move from a greenhouse or tray into open garden soil. During those first several days, the stems stay soft and the root system has not yet fully anchored the plant.

That combination makes newly set cabbage, broccoli, cauliflower, and kale especially tempting targets for cutworms already active in the soil from earlier summer feeding cycles.

Michigan gardeners who set fall transplants in August and early September are working right during the window when late-season cutworm larvae are still feeding actively.

A transplant that looks healthy at planting can be clipped at the base overnight, leaving behind a frustrating gap in your carefully planned fall bed.

Checking the base of each transplant every morning during the first week is one of the simplest habits that pays off quickly.

One of the most reliable physical protections is a collar placed around the stem at planting time. Cut a strip of cardboard, a section of a plastic cup, or a short length of stiff paper into a ring about three inches tall.

Press it about an inch into the soil so it surrounds the stem without touching it tightly. This barrier makes it much harder for a cutworm to reach the stem from the side.

As the transplant grows and the stem thickens and toughens over the following two to three weeks, the collar becomes less critical.

But during those vulnerable early days after transplanting, that simple ring of material can be the difference between a thriving fall plant and a missing one.

5. Near Weedy Garden Edges

Near Weedy Garden Edges

Garden edges are easy to overlook when you are focused on the rows inside the bed, but those weedy borders deserve serious attention during fall planting season.

Cutworm moths lay eggs on grass, chickweed, mustard relatives, and other low-growing plants that commonly line the edges of Michigan vegetable gardens.

The larvae hatch, feed on that vegetation, and then shift their attention toward softer, more tender targets as those weeds start to dry out or decline in late summer.

That movement from weedy border to freshly planted vegetable row is a predictable pattern, and it explains why damage often appears first along the outer edges of a bed rather than in the center.

Seedlings planted closest to an unmowed grass strip or a dense clump of chickweed tend to show cutworm activity before plants deeper in the garden do.

Recognizing that pattern helps you know exactly where to focus your early morning scouting.

Keeping the immediate area around your fall planting reasonably clear of weeds and tall grass reduces the number of larvae that might migrate inward. A mowed or cultivated border strip of even a foot or two can make a noticeable difference.

Just be careful about deep or aggressive cultivation right next to young vegetable rows, because that can disturb the shallow roots of your seedlings.

Light surface weeding and hand-pulling near the planting edge is usually enough to reduce weed cover without stressing the vegetables.

Consistent edge maintenance throughout late summer and fall is one of the quietest and most effective ways to reduce cutworm pressure before it reaches your crops.

6. Beneath Mulch And Plant Debris

Beneath Mulch And Plant Debris

Mulch does a fantastic job of holding moisture, moderating soil temperature, and keeping weeds down, which is exactly why so many Michigan gardeners use it heavily in fall beds.

The problem is that thick layers of organic material, old crop residue, boards, or dense plant debris also create the kind of dark, cool, sheltered environment that cutworms love for daytime hiding.

A larva can rest comfortably under a mat of straw or old leaves all day and then emerge after dark to feed on nearby seedlings.

Checking beneath loose debris close to any clipped or wilting seedlings often turns up the culprit resting just a short distance away. Lift the material carefully and look for a plump, smooth larva curled in a C shape against the soil.

Gardens that went through a full summer growing season tend to accumulate more debris, and that buildup can harbor more larvae heading into fall planting time.

Temporarily pulling back heavy mulch from directly around very young seedlings in areas where you have already spotted cutworm activity is a reasonable short-term step.

Once seedlings grow past the most vulnerable stage and stems toughen up, you can replace the mulch without as much concern.

The goal is not to eliminate mulch entirely, because it genuinely helps fall crops through temperature swings. Instead, think about keeping a small clear zone right at the stem base and reducing the thickest layers closest to the plant until it gains some size and strength.

Staying aware of what lives beneath the surface layer keeps your scouting accurate and your seedlings better protected.

7. On Lower Leaves And Growing Points

On Lower Leaves And Growing Points

Most people picture cutworms working strictly at ground level, but not every species stays down there.

Climbing cutworms are a real thing, and they move upward along the stem to feed on lower leaves, tender growing points, and young plant tissue before any stem clipping happens below.

If you see irregular holes in the lower leaves of your fall seedlings or notice that the central growing point looks ragged or missing, a climbing cutworm could be responsible.

The tricky part is that this kind of foliage damage looks similar to what slugs, flea beetles, and small caterpillars leave behind.

Flea beetle feeding tends to create tiny round holes scattered across the leaf surface, while slug feeding often shows a slimier, more irregular pattern.

Cutworm feeding on leaves usually appears as larger, chewed-out sections or notches along the leaf edge, sometimes removing whole portions of a lower leaf overnight.

Going out after dark with a small flashlight is genuinely one of the best ways to sort out which pest is actually feeding on your plants.

Cutworms are most active in the first few hours after sunset, so checking between 9 and 11 at night often reveals them on the plant or on the soil surface nearby.

Compare what you find with common Michigan garden pests before deciding on any response, because accurate identification saves time and effort.

Protecting the growing point is especially important because a seedling that loses its central growing tip early on will struggle to recover and may not produce a usable fall crop at all.

8. In Damp Sheltered Areas Near Field Edges

In Damp Sheltered Areas Near Field Edges

Some corners of a Michigan garden just feel different from the rest: lower spots that stay moist longer, areas bordering a weedy field edge, sections near a drainage ditch, or beds tucked against a dense row of tall vegetation.

Those damp, sheltered zones are prime real estate for late-season cutworm larvae because the soil stays loose and cool, cover is plentiful, and tender fall seedlings are often planted nearby. Damage concentrated in one corner or along one side of a bed is a useful clue.

When several seedlings in a sheltered, low-lying area show signs of clipping while the rest of the garden looks fine, the surrounding environment is likely contributing to higher larva activity there.

Organic soils with high moisture-holding capacity are especially common in Michigan gardens near wetlands or field edges, and those conditions support more cutworm activity through the fall season.

Searching within a few feet of any clipped seedling is always worth the effort because the larva rarely travels far before settling back into the soil.

Early morning scouting, right around sunrise, catches larvae that have not yet retreated fully underground.

Checking after dark with a flashlight is equally effective and sometimes even more productive.

Before responding to any damage, take a moment to confirm you are actually dealing with a cutworm rather than another pest, since accurate identification shapes the best course of action.

As your fall seedlings grow taller and their stems thicken and harden over the following weeks, their vulnerability decreases naturally, and your garden gains steady ground against further cutworm pressure.
